Who Is Credit Adjustments Inc.?
Credit Adjustments Inc. (CAI) is a third-party debt collection agency that collects debts on behalf of creditors, including student loans. They have been in business for over 54 years and operate out of Defiance, Ohio.

Recognizing Harassment by CAI: Be Aware!
Debt collection harassment includes abusive, threatening, or deceptive practices. Watch for:
Calls at unusual hours (before 8:00 a.m. or after 9:00 p.m.)
Failing to provide written notice of your debt and your rights
If these occur, they may violate federal law (FDCPA) and give you the right to take action.
What to Do If You Are Harassed
Know your rights under FDCPA, FCRA, and state laws.
Request debt validation in writing to confirm the debt is yours.
Document all communications: phone calls, letters, emails, dates, times, and details.
Do not provide personal info until the debt is verified.
Send a written cease-and-desist letter if harassment continues.
Consult a consumer rights attorney to enforce your rights or recover damages.

FAQs
Is Credit Adjustments Inc. a scam?
No, CAI is a legitimate debt collection agency with over 54 years in business, not a scam.
Can CAI garnish my wages?
Yes, CAI can garnish wages for federal student loans or court-ordered debts within legal limits.
Can Credit Adjustments Inc. sue me?
Yes, they may sue if the debt is within the legal statute of limitations in your state.
Can CAI report my debt to credit bureaus?
Yes, but you can dispute inaccurate or outdated debts reported to credit agencies.
Can CAI arrest me?
No, debt collectors can’t arrest you, but failing a court order may result in legal consequences.
What tactics by CAI may violate the FDCPA?
Repeated calls, threats, profanity, late-night calls, or contacting family may violate your FDCPA rights.
What are my rights under the FDCPA?
You have the right to dispute debt, stop contact, and sue for harassment or false threats.
